$CAKE Proposal 3.0, similar to the previous 2.0 proposal, continues to reduce CAKE staking rewards. In the long term, this is positive; in the short term, it's hard to say. Previously, due to reduced staking profits, large holders sold off aggressively, and this time may be similar. For the long term, reducing or possibly eliminating these staking rewards may not impact the project significantly, just a short-term price effect.
